Ingredients You’ll Need
To create the perfect crockpot mac and cheese, gather the following ingredients:
- Pasta: 16 oz elbow macaroni (or any pasta of your choice)
- Cheese: A blend of 3-4 cups shredded cheese (cheddar, mozzarella, and/or gouda for extra creaminess)
- Milk: 2 cups of whole milk or half-and-half
- Cream Cheese: 8 oz, cubed (this creates a rich, creamy texture)
- Butter: 4 tablespoons, melted
- Seasonings: Salt, pepper, and a pinch of garlic powder for added flavor
- Toppings: Optional breadcrumbs or additional cheese for a crunchy topping
Step-by-Step Instructions
1. Prepare the Pasta
Start by cooking your elbow macaroni according to the package instructions. Aim for al dente, as the pasta will continue to cook in the crockpot. Once done, drain and set aside.
2. Mix the Cheese Sauce
In a large bowl, combine the cubed cream cheese, melted butter, milk, and your choice of shredded cheese. Stir until smooth and well incorporated. Add salt, pepper, and garlic powder to taste.
3. Combine in the Crockpot
In your crockpot, layer the cooked pasta and pour the cheese sauce mixture over it. Stir gently to ensure the pasta is evenly coated with the creamy sauce.
4. Set the Crockpot
Cover the crockpot and set it to low for about 2-3 hours, or on high for around 1-1.5 hours. Stir occasionally to promote even cooking and prevent sticking.
5. Add Toppings (Optional)
If you prefer a crunchy texture, about 15 minutes before serving, sprinkle breadcrumbs or additional cheese on top. Cover again for the final moments of cooking to allow a beautiful cheesy crust to form.
6. Serve and Enjoy
Once the mac and cheese is cooked to perfection, serve it warm and enjoy! Pair it with a side salad or your favorite protein for a complete meal.
Tips for Customization
- Protein Additions: Consider adding cooked bacon, diced ham, or shredded chicken for a heartier dish.
- Veggie Boost: Broccoli, spinach, or tomatoes can be added for a nutritional boost.
- Spice Things Up: For a bit of heat, mix in jalapeños or crushed red pepper flakes.
